Mastering Difficult Conversations: A Guide to Graceful and Respectful Communication

Difficult conversations are inevitable in both our personal and professional lives. However, the way we approach these interactions significantly impacts their outcome. As an expert in communication and interpersonal skills, I'll guide you through effective strategies to navigate these challenges with grace, respect, and ultimately, positive results. This isn't about avoiding conflict; it's about managing it constructively.

Preparation is Key: Laying the Foundation for Success

Before engaging in a challenging conversation, take time for self-reflection. Acknowledge your emotions – anxiety, frustration, or even anger are normal. Approaching the conversation with a calm and open mindset is crucial. Consider what you hope to achieve and what your ideal outcome looks like. This mental preparation significantly influences your ability to communicate effectively.

Timing and Environment: Setting the Stage for Productive Dialogue

The setting plays a vital role. Choose a time and place where both parties feel comfortable and uninterrupted. A quiet, private space free from distractions allows for focused attention and minimizes external pressures. Consider the other person's schedule and preferences to ensure mutual convenience.

Active Listening: The Cornerstone of Understanding

Active listening is paramount. This goes beyond simply hearing; it's about fully engaging with the speaker. Maintain eye contact, offer nonverbal cues of attentiveness (nodding, appropriate facial expressions), and summarize their points to ensure understanding. This demonstrates respect and builds trust, fostering a more collaborative atmosphere.

"I" Statements: Owning Your Perspective

Frame your thoughts and feelings using "I" statements. Instead of accusatory "you" statements, focus on expressing your own experiences and perspectives. For instance, say "I feel frustrated when..." instead of "You always...". This approach prevents defensiveness and promotes a more constructive dialogue.

Empathy: Stepping into Another's Shoes

Empathy is the bridge to understanding. Try to see the situation from the other person's perspective. Acknowledge their feelings, even if you don't necessarily agree with them. Validating their experiences creates a safe space for open and honest communication.

Focus on the Issue, Not the Person: Separating the Problem from the Individual

Keep the conversation centered on the issue at hand, not personal attacks. Address the specific problem, avoiding generalizations or blame. This fosters a solution-oriented approach rather than escalating the conflict.

Choosing Your Words Carefully: The Power of Language

Use clear, concise, and respectful language. Avoid inflammatory words or tones that could escalate the situation. Remember, your word choices directly influence the conversation's trajectory. Consider your tone of voice as well; a calm and measured tone de-escalates tension more effectively.

Patience: A Virtue in Challenging Conversations

Difficult conversations often involve strong emotions. Practice patience; allow ample time for each person to express themselves fully. If needed, take short breaks to regroup and regain composure. Rushing the process hinders understanding and prevents a mutually agreeable resolution.

Finding Common Ground: Building Bridges of Understanding

Identify shared goals or values. Highlighting common interests fosters a sense of unity and cooperation. Focusing on shared objectives creates a foundation for finding mutually beneficial solutions.

Apologizing When Necessary: Humility and Reconciliation

If you've made a mistake, apologize sincerely. Taking responsibility demonstrates humility and helps rebuild trust. A genuine apology can significantly improve the conversation's dynamic and pave the way for reconciliation.

Nonverbal Communication: Reading the Unspoken Signals

Pay close attention to nonverbal cues – body language, facial expressions, tone of voice. These often convey more than words alone. Being mindful of these cues helps you understand the other person's emotional state and adapt your communication style accordingly.

Maintaining Composure: Staying Calm Under Pressure

Even if the conversation becomes heated, maintain your composure. Deep breaths, a steady tone, and avoiding defensiveness are essential. Responding with grace and calmness can effectively defuse tense situations.

The Power of Questions: Guiding the Conversation

Ask open-ended questions to encourage dialogue and clarify any misunderstandings. This demonstrates genuine interest and promotes active participation from both sides. Open-ended questions elicit more information and help ensure everyone feels heard.

Focusing on Solutions: A Path to Resolution

Shift the focus from dwelling on the problem to brainstorming solutions collaboratively. Explore various options and work together to find a mutually acceptable resolution. This approach creates a more positive and forward-looking atmosphere.

Reflection and Learning: Continuous Growth

After the conversation, reflect on what went well and what could be improved. Every challenging interaction is a learning opportunity. Analyze your approach, identify areas for improvement, and integrate these lessons into future conversations to refine your communication skills.

In conclusion, mastering difficult conversations is a skill honed through practice and self-awareness. By combining empathy, active listening, thoughtful communication techniques, and a commitment to respectful dialogue, you can transform challenging interactions into opportunities for growth and understanding.
